Pricing
Suntech Power
Contact
No bio yet
Location
Wuxi, China
Links
Wenbin Li
Senior Technical Services Engineer
6 people, 0 jobs
Suntech is a worldwide leader in the design and manufacture of innovative solar energy solutions for a wide variety of customers and applications.
Industries
Headquarters
Employees
TotalEnergies
Doctolib
iOPEX Technologies
Lummus Technology
Jet2
View more